biomechanics - ANSWERSthe application of the principles of mechanics to the living human body 
 
kinesiology - ANSWERSthe combination of art and science, the study of human movement 
 
clinical kinesiology - ANSWERSthe application of kinesiology to environments of the health care professional 
 
clinical kinesiology - ANSWERSThe purpose of this is to prevent injury, restore function, and provide optimal performance
